# Break-Glass: Catalog Cache Invalidation

Scope: the Pinrow product catalog at Veldstone Retail. If stale prices persist after a purge and the Hollowmere invalidation queue is wedged, use break-glass to flush the edge tier directly. Contractors: get verbal sign-off from the catalog lead first. Steps: open the Hollowmere admin shell, select emergency-flush, confirm the tenant, and run it once — repeated flushes thrash the origin. Access is logged and expires after 20 minutes. Unseal the admin shell with the passphrase below.

recovery phrase for kahop-tajog: istix-casvan

## Deployment

The Gildercrest seat-map renderer ships as a single container behind the venue gateway. Support staff should know that each theatre (Main Stage, Lantern Hall) gets its own renderer instance; seat layouts are cached for ten minutes, so layout edits may not appear immediately. Restarting the instance clears the cache. Deploys happen Tuesdays. If a customer reports stale maps outside that window, check the instance against the current configuration values, shown below.

deployment values, yadug-bawif:
[framir]
team = pelox
access_code = ac_a38ab2
owner = tamion.julael
host = framir.tolvaqlabs.test
port = 11211
peer = tammir.zemvargrid.local
salt = 2215ef03
pin = 1541

Handover: Murkwell alert deduplicator

Dedup windows were tuned last Thursday after the paging storm; false merges are down but watch for alerts from the batch cluster, which still occasionally collapse into one incident. Restarting the service clears the in-memory dedup cache, so expect a brief burst of duplicates afterward. The service currently runs with the values below.

config for kafof-bawef:
holath:
  log_level: debug
  metrics_host: metrics.holath.qorvelsys.internal
  pin: 2191
  pool_size: 32